Q: Is 220,564,434 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 220,564,434 is not a prime number.

Why is 220,564,434 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 220564434 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 23 46 69 138 529 1,058 1,587 3,174 69,491 138,982 208,473 416,946 1,598,293 3,196,586 4,794,879 9,589,758 36,760,739 73,521,478 110,282,217 and 220,564,434, with no remainder.

Since 220,564,434 cannot be divided by just 1 and 220,564,434, it is not a prime number.
